According to the Centers for Disease Control, osteoarthritis impacts over 32.5 million adults in America and can affect patients in their teens and twenties to older adults. Extracorporeal Shockwave Therapy (ESWT) and Extracorporeal Magnetotransduction Therapy (EMTT) are innovative medical technologies that enable medical professionals to treat osteoarthritis non-invasively and help patients get better faster, minus risk and downtime.
Because osteoarthritis is considered the most common cause of disability among adults in this country, it's critical to utilize effective, therapeutic approaches that minimize its impact.

Shockwave therapy uses targeted acoustic pressure waves to stimulate tissue repair, reduce inflammation, and improve pain in joints affected by osteoarthritis. It is non-invasive and can be an option when conservative treatments are insufficient.
EMTT (Extracorporeal Magnetotransduction Therapy) uses high-energy electromagnetic pulses, while Shockwave therapy uses mechanical pressure waves; both stimulate healing, but through different mechanisms. Together, they can complement each other for broader therapeutic effects.
Yes, Shockwave therapy has been shown to reduce pain and improve function in some patients with osteoarthritis by promoting tissue repair and modulating pain pathways. Outcomes depend on individual patient factors and treatment parameters.
EMTT may support symptom improvement in osteoarthritis by enhancing circulation and cellular activity in affected areas, potentially aiding tissue recovery and reducing discomfort. It’s often considered alongside other regenerative therapies.
Treatment protocols vary by condition severity and individual response, but most patients undergo multiple sessions over several weeks to achieve optimal results; clinicians adjust frequency based on progress.
Good candidates are patients with osteoarthritis pain and functional limitations who have not achieved adequate relief from standard conservative care and want a non-invasive alternative. Clinician evaluation determines appropriateness.
Yes, Shockwave therapy can be integrated with physical therapy, orthobiologics, and other non-surgical treatments as part of a comprehensive plan to manage osteoarthritis symptoms and support joint health.
Yes. Both Shockwave therapy and EMTT are generally considered safe, non-invasive treatments with minimal side effects when performed by trained clinicians.
